If you’re the sort that eats, drinks and sleeps football, you might be interested in HTC’s UEFA Collector’s Edition One M8 smartphone.
Announced in partnership with UK retailed Carphone Warehouse at an event with Manchester United legend Peter Schmeichel and Arsenal Women’s goalkeeper Emma Byrne. The smartphone itself is a vanilla version of the HTC One M8 but it comes engraved with every Champions League winning team on the back of the chassis, from Marseille in 1992 to Real’s 10th tournament last season. This isn’t the first UEFA themed smartphone HTC has released either, with them releasing a similar one last year with a trophy engraved at the rear.
But if you want to get your hands on one, you will have to join the competition that the brand will be running through their Facebook, Twitter and G+ pages.
